Difference between revisions of "User:Minooz/OSD600/buildFF"
< User:Minooz | OSD600
(→Build Firefox) |
|||
Line 3: | Line 3: | ||
:[[Real_World_Mozilla_Build_Mozilla_Lab]] | :[[Real_World_Mozilla_Build_Mozilla_Lab]] | ||
: [[Mozilla_Community | Mozilla Community]] | : [[Mozilla_Community | Mozilla Community]] | ||
+ | |||
: Build instructions @ [https://developer.mozilla.org/En/Developer_Guide/Build_Instructions developer.mozilla.org] | : Build instructions @ [https://developer.mozilla.org/En/Developer_Guide/Build_Instructions developer.mozilla.org] | ||
:: [https://developer.mozilla.org/En/Developer_Guide/Build_Instructions/Windows_Prerequisites Windows Prerequisites ] | :: [https://developer.mozilla.org/En/Developer_Guide/Build_Instructions/Windows_Prerequisites Windows Prerequisites ] | ||
Line 10: | Line 11: | ||
: [http://zenit.senecac.on.ca/wiki/index.php/FAQ FAQ] | : [http://zenit.senecac.on.ca/wiki/index.php/FAQ FAQ] | ||
: [http://zenit.senecac.on.ca/wiki/index.php/Fall_2007_Weekly_Schedule Fall 2007] | : [http://zenit.senecac.on.ca/wiki/index.php/Fall_2007_Weekly_Schedule Fall 2007] | ||
+ | : [http://zenit.senecac.on.ca/wiki/index.php/DPS909_and_OSD600_Fall_2010_Weekly_Schedule Fall 2010] | ||
: [http://zenit.senecac.on.ca/wiki/index.php/DPS909 DPS909] | : [http://zenit.senecac.on.ca/wiki/index.php/DPS909 DPS909] | ||
* Problems: | * Problems: | ||
: [https://developer.mozilla.org/En/Windows_SDK_versions#Windows_7_SDK Windows SDK configuration] | : [https://developer.mozilla.org/En/Windows_SDK_versions#Windows_7_SDK Windows SDK configuration] | ||
: Needed to upgrade to [http://www.microsoft.com/downloads/en/confirmation.aspx?FamilyID=9cfb2d51-5ff4-4491-b0e5-b386f32c0992&displaylang=en.Net Framework 4] and [http://www.microsoft.com/downloads/en/confirmation.aspx?FamilyID=6b6c21d2-2006-4afa-9702-529fa782d63b&displaylang=en SDK 7] | : Needed to upgrade to [http://www.microsoft.com/downloads/en/confirmation.aspx?FamilyID=9cfb2d51-5ff4-4491-b0e5-b386f32c0992&displaylang=en.Net Framework 4] and [http://www.microsoft.com/downloads/en/confirmation.aspx?FamilyID=6b6c21d2-2006-4afa-9702-529fa782d63b&displaylang=en SDK 7] | ||
+ | |||
+ | I followed the instructions on [http://annasob.wordpress.com/category/build/ annasob's blog] on how to build firefox on different platforms, also took a look at Build instructions @ [https://developer.mozilla.org/En/Developer_Guide/Build_Instructions developer.mozilla.org]. | ||
+ | |||
+ | First, I tried to build firefox on Vista: | ||
+ | |||
+ | - Intel Processor Dual Core 2.0 Ghz | ||
+ | - 2GB DDR2 memory | ||
+ | - Windows Vista 32bit | ||
+ | - Visual Studio 2010 | ||
+ | and my .mozconfig looked like this: | ||
+ | |||
+ | <code> | ||
+ | |||
+ | . $topsrcdir/browser/config/mozconfig | ||
+ | mk_add_options MOZ_OBJDIR=@TOPSRCDIR@/objdir-ff-release | ||
+ | mk_add_options MOZ_MAKE_FLAGS="-j2" | ||
+ | mk_add_options MOZ_CO_PROJECT=browser | ||
+ | |||
+ | ac_add_options --enable-application=browser | ||
+ | ac_add_options --disable-optimize | ||
+ | ac_add_options --enable-debug | ||
+ | </code> |
Revision as of 21:38, 19 January 2011
Build Firefox
- Links:
- Build instructions @ developer.mozilla.org
- Blogs:
- Anna:annasob Blog1 - old blog
- Scott:[1]
- FAQ
- Fall 2007
- Fall 2010
- DPS909
- Problems:
- Windows SDK configuration
- Needed to upgrade to Framework 4 and SDK 7
I followed the instructions on annasob's blog on how to build firefox on different platforms, also took a look at Build instructions @ developer.mozilla.org.
First, I tried to build firefox on Vista:
- Intel Processor Dual Core 2.0 Ghz - 2GB DDR2 memory - Windows Vista 32bit - Visual Studio 2010 and my .mozconfig looked like this:
. $topsrcdir/browser/config/mozconfig mk_add_options MOZ_OBJDIR=@TOPSRCDIR@/objdir-ff-release mk_add_options MOZ_MAKE_FLAGS="-j2" mk_add_options MOZ_CO_PROJECT=browser
ac_add_options --enable-application=browser ac_add_options --disable-optimize ac_add_options --enable-debug